To ensure your tilapia is cooked to the correct temperature, use a food thermometer to check that the internal temperature reaches 145F (63C). This will ensure that the fish is cooked safely and thoroughly.
To properly thaw frozen tilapia, place it in the refrigerator overnight or use the defrost setting on the microwave. Avoid thawing at room temperature to prevent bacteria growth.
Tilapia should be cooked on the grill for about 4-6 minutes per side, or until it reaches an internal temperature of 145F.
